This starts with offering Mathews an extension.
15 Million / season for 8 yrs.
If he doesn't sign it... trade him.
If he does sign it... you then have to decide "Do we trade Nylander and keep Marner.... or sign Nylander and Trade Marner". For me that's the dilemma.
Personally (and this is based on last three years of play-offs) I keep Nylander. The Leafs had 5 guys who stepped up and brought it for these two play-off rounds - Morgan RIelly, Noel Acciari, Luke Schenn, WIlliam Nylander and David Kampf. You can nit-pick all you want and say "Kampf was useless in such-and-such a game, or Nylander disappeared for a couple of games", but over-all I think they rose to the occasion more often than not.
The guys who under-performed were Holl (just awful), Giordano (too old and slow), Mccabe (too often outclassed), Jarnkrok (That was 11 games of absolutely nothing), Marner (too soft for play-off hockey), Mathews (a complete mystery to me) and Kerfoot (just not a factor).
The reasons for keeping Mathews are simple - he's a superstar who can score 50-60 goals. You can't just toss that aside. But Marner, as skilled as he is... continuosly shows that he is not built for play-off hockey. Other than game two vs Tampa... he was a complete mess. I have said this for 4 years now "All a team has to do is shut-down Marner and you eliminate 50% of Mathews offense." With nobody to make room for Mathews, he becomes useless. He cannot drive play on his own.
If Mathews signs and you extend Nylander (10 million for 8 yrs - which is fair value)... YOU HAVE TO TRADE MARNER!!!
The key to fixing this team is 11.6 million in cap space to use on the type of depth players you need to compete in the play-offs and a NEW COACH!!!
Sheldon Keefe... sorry, I like you and think you're a good coach... but we need another level of coaching.
BARRY TROTZ!!!!
... and that's a no brainer.

Just to add.... with Marner gone and 11.6 Million in cap space - I would resign David Kampf (priority)... re-sign Noel Acciari (this is a Toronto player!!!!)... re-sign Ryan O'Rielly (if he's willing to sign in the 4-5 Mill range) and bring back LUKE SCHENN!!!
